The homescreen is simple but very unique at the same time with 3 banners for easy readability with the main feature being the battery and signal meter graph placed for very easy viewing. I am one that always wants to know my battery and signal strength and BB Design Worx has made this the main feature of the homescreen with an easy to read graph that functioned just as it is supposed to. I wanted to test the signal graph so I used it in different environments along side my Wife’s Blackberry Curve and it was spot on as was the battery meter. I have to tip my hat to BB Design Worx for this impressive design.

Above the battery and signal graph sits another banner that holds 15 user customizable scrolling Icons that show you 5 Icons at a time, a feature I always enjoy, as I can stay on the homescreen and access all of my favorite Icons. Navigating the scrolling Icon dock was very smooth giving you 3 screens of 5 Icons at a time to total your 15. The slim banner on the bottom of the screen holds all your notifications for easy viewing and the slim top banner has the time, date and connection indications. .

The more I used the theme the more I began to like the lime green look with black Icons designed by BB Design Worx and after using the Greyscale theme the Icons, being the same, are well made and fit right in with my 3rd party Icons. Just as their previous theme a lot of hotspots are available so you may never have to leave the homescreen and the wallpaper, that cannot be changed, is made with shades of black and soft grey to really bring out the prominent green style of the theme..
